#![feature(test)]
extern crate slice_ring_buffer;
extern crate test;
use std::collections::VecDeque;
fn alloc_granularity_cap(factor: usize) -> usize {
let mut deq = VecDeque::<u8>::with_capacity(1);
let cap = deq.capacity();
let new_cap = factor * cap + 1;
deq.resize(new_cap, 0);
deq.capacity()
}
#[inline(always)]
fn alloc_and_flush(cap: usize) {
let mut deq = VecDeque::<u8>::with_capacity(cap);
deq.push_back(1);
test::black_box(&mut deq.get_mut(0));
test::black_box(&mut deq);
}
macro_rules! alloc {
($name:ident, $factor:expr) => {
#[bench]
fn $name(b: &mut test::Bencher) {
let cap = alloc_granularity_cap($factor);
b.iter(|| {
alloc_and_flush(cap);
});
}
};
}
